How Why I Just Want to Talk to Him All the Time Meme Explained Actually Works

At its core, this meme is built around a short, catchy sentence that many people can recognize in their own lives. The structure usually pairs the phrase with an image or video that illustrates a specific situation, such as checking a phone repeatedly, replaying a message notification, or smiling at a remembered conversation. The humor comes from the gap between ordinary moments and the strong desire for closeness they trigger. Viewers laugh because the scenario feels slightly exaggerated but also uncomfortably familiar.

To understand the mechanics, think of the meme as a template. The phrase acts as the caption, while the visual provides context that can shift from mildly awkward to sweetly funny. Someone might post a screenshot of a chat with just a few delayed replies, adding the phrase to highlight how much they are looking forward to the next exchange. Another version could show two people sitting close together but both absorbed in their devices, underscoring how digital communication has woven itself into everyday life. Because the format is simple, it encourages participation, allowing users to insert their own stories while staying within the recognizable pattern of “Why I Just Want to Talk to Him All the Time Meme Explained.”

Things People Often Misunderstand

One widespread misunderstanding is that the meme is purely about romance or that it encourages obsession. In reality, many uses of the phrase highlight simple companionship, the joy of small exchanges, or even admiration for someone’s ideas or energy. The focus is often less on constant physical presence and more on the comfort of knowing someone is regularly reachable in a digital space. By clarifying this distinction, the meme can be seen as a commentary on modern connection rather than a call for excessive attention.

Another misconception is that the humor relies on making the other person seem unattainable or disinterested. More often, the joke comes from the speaker’s own anticipation and the gap between messages or moments. It is the feeling of waiting in a positive, hopeful way rather than the frustration of being ignored. Recognizing this subtle difference shifts the narrative from anxiety to lighthearted self-awareness. When people interpret the meme in this balanced way, it becomes easier to appreciate its humor without misreading the underlying sentiment.
